Output fc62dbec3d103c51b7f5ee4b5a15dd31dc9b84b31a9caf668c2f73e9ef8f9061:0

value
741790
script pubkey
OP_0 OP_PUSHBYTES_20 5b317a1ba56b0fd2d10d66ad442f398dfc244cac
address
bc1qtvch5xa9dv8a95gdv6k5gtee3h7zgn9vjlc09f
transaction
fc62dbec3d103c51b7f5ee4b5a15dd31dc9b84b31a9caf668c2f73e9ef8f9061
confirmations
48366
spent
true